Online Class Availability at LeTourneau University
Online coursework is an option at LeTourneau University. Of 3,330 students, 1,292 (39%) were enrolled entirely in distance education and 662 (20%) took at least some classes online.

Bioengineering Bachelor’s Program at LeTourneau University
Among the 7 bachelor’s bioengineering graduates at LeTourneau University, 57% were women (4) and 43% were men (3).
The following table and chart show the race/ethnicity of Bioengineering bachelor’s degree recipients at LeTourneau University.
| Race / Ethnicity | Number of Graduates |
|---|---|
| White | 5 |
| Black / African American | 1 |
| Two or More Races | 1 |
Minority students account for 29% of Bioengineering bachelor’s degree recipients at LeTourneau University, lower than the national average of 44%.*
